Which term refers to a date or time before which something must be completed?

Explanation:
A deadline is the latest date or time by which something must be completed. This term is used to set a due date for tasks, submissions, or performances, giving you a clear cutoff to work toward. In contrast, tempo refers to the speed of the music, ritardando indicates a gradual slowdown, and dynamics describe how loudly or softly the music should be played. So the term that fits the description of a required completion time is deadline.
